    Size

    Sectional sofas can provide a lot of seating space and are ideal for rooms with smaller spaces. They can also be redesigned to fit the pull-out couch in your room. This lets you maximize your seating while still having space for guests. Some sectional sleepers feature a hidden trundle beds that slide under the chaise, and then rearranges into a larger mattress. Some sectional sleepers have an under-bed storage compartment that can be used to store the mattress when it is folded. Some beds can be converted and can be used as a chair or loveseat when not in use.

    When you are looking for a sectional sofa bed, you should always consider the size of your living room, as well as the dimensions of the sleeper. This will help narrow down your choices and locate the right couch for your space. You should also look for other features such as reclining capabilities and the number of pieces included in the set.

    Some sectional sofas can be converted into beds in just one step, while others will require you to take off the seat cushions at the top before pulling out the trundle and revealing the queen-sized bed. This is a great option for those who have limited storage space in their living room, as they can keep the mattress in a hidden place when not being used. It is also a great option for those who prefer to sleep on a mattress that is firmer.

    Storage

    The ability of the sofa to convert into the bed is a fantastic way to transform small spaces into a comfortable space for guests. A majority of sectionals include a storage ottoman or chaise to keep pillows and blankets handy for guests. Some even come with an extra storage compartment hidden beneath the seat cushion that's accessible via a simple pull-up handle.

    The range of fabrics and colors for a sectional with pull out Bed and Storage sleeper is nearly endless. Joybird is one example. It offers more than 80 different fabric swatches, including performance fabrics that are simple to clean and sturdy enough to stand up to pets and children. You'll also find a wide selection of chenille and knit velvet alternatives and sustainable fabrics that are eco-friendly.

    There are a variety of designs to pick from, including reversible sections that allow you to switch the chaise lounge from right to left facing to better fit your living space. The Everly sofa that is reversible, for instance, has two-tone design that has a black faux leather base paired with grey upholstery. You can also modify the design by adding or removing pieces.

    Certain sectionals arrive as one big piece, and others arrive in modular boxes that you put together on site. Be sure to check the furniture's sizing and shipping information prior to you purchase to ensure it will fit through your front door and hallways, narrow corners, and your building's elevator and stairwells if you reside in a condominium or apartment.

    You'll have to consider whether you'd rather an innerspring mattress or a foam one, and the style of frame. Innerspring mattresses are generally more sturdier than foam and they are an elegant design that is suited to the majority of rooms. Foam mattresses may be soft and comfortable but they don't offer the same level of support for larger guests. Some people prefer a wood frame for its classic look and durability, whereas others prefer a metal or an iron frame since it's easy to install.

    Comfort

    The comfort of your sleeper sofa section depends on many aspects, including its size and mattress type. A good mattress provides ample support and a comfortable feeling to the mattress, which helps your guests sleep comfortably. You can choose from a range of styles that include innerspring and memory foam, which will meet your needs. Choose a mattress that is long-lasting, easy-to-clean and maintain, and is a good fit for the design of your room.

    The fabric used in your sectional bed can add in its comfort. Choose a fabric that is durable and is resistant to stains, dirt and everyday wear and complements the decor of your room. Raymour & Flanigan's Milo sleeper sofa sectional for example, features soft cushions that effortlessly wipe down and blends with different styles of décor. The reversible chaise allows you to put the sofa on either the right or left side of the room.

    When shopping for a sectional sleeper, take a look at the construction and the mechanism of the couch to ensure it's made well. Make sure it fits your space and meets the amount of people you'll want to sleep and seat. Also, test the mattress to determine its comfort level. For instance, an innerspring sleeper sofa could give a bit more bounce and feel of support, while the memory foam model provides the comfort of a contoured mattress.

    Some sleeper sofas with sectional design have frames for beds that are built into the frame and mattress to transform into an easy sleeping surface. Some require you to fold out the cushions for the seat on the top of the sofa. If you're interested in the latter option, consider opting for a sectional sofa that has a pull out or futon mattress, since they are easier to transform.

    Some sleeper sectionals include storage for pillows, blankets and other bedding items. They are great to keep guests' belongings in order and easily accessible. Sectional couches with storage are available in many sizes and styles. From small 2-piece options to larger L-shaped models, you'll find them all. Choose from a wide range of fabrics including prints and solids that are suitable for your space.

    Style

    A sleeper sofa could be a great choice for a guest room or playroom, or even a home office. It's also a stylish and comfortable addition to your living space or family room. With a little research you can locate the right sectional sofa with a pull-out bed that meets your needs. Experts recommend considering size and configuration, mattress type and cushion quality. You may also decide by price and style.

    The first step is to determine the number of seats you'd like. You will need to know your overall size, as well as the dimensions of your windows and doors. If you're able to measure the area, then mark it with masking tape so you can compare the sectional models you're looking at when you shop.

    When choosing a sleeper sectional take into consideration whether you're looking for an L-shaped or U-shaped design. L-shaped sectionals are the most popular however U-shaped models are also available. Both designs let you add a chaise or additional seating at one end of the sectional, creating an even more flexible seating arrangement.

    While the majority of sleeper sectionals and sofa beds are upholstered in neutral shades, you can also find them in hues that are in harmony with your style. You'll find a wide range of upholstery options, such as Chenille and linen, as well as performance fabrics that offer water absorption and stain resistance. Leather and microfiber are the most well-known materials, but there are also viscose, cotton, and velvet.

    A mattress with a high density is the key to an excellent sleeper's sectional. Choose mattresses with the addition of memory foam, which provides greater support and a more rounded shape to the body, or a mix of innerspring and foam that's durable and comfortable.
